Perusall

Perusall is a versatile engagement and assessment tool, available to all ASU courses. Students read and annotate learning materials (articles, videos), submit files, and take quizzes. These components can be combined to create a multi-part assignment, making the most of autograding features.
Instructors can fully customize grading, including metrics for engagement time, student comments and interactions, peer rubric scores, and quizzes. Uniquely, Perusall offers an algorithm-based quality score for student comments. Read more about automatic grading configuration in Perusall.

Harmonize

Harmonize is a discussion tool available to ASU Online courses. It allows instructors to set multiple participation “milestones” and automatically passes grades to Canvas, requiring fewer actions by the instructor. It even allows grading for late submissions. Playposit

PlayPosit is an interactive video platform that allows instructors to embed activities and quizzes into videos from platforms like YouTube, Vimeo, and Khan Academy. These video activities, called “Bulbs,” capture student engagement and interactions and can be graded. Read more about Playposit automated grading.

Yellowdig

Yellowdig is a community-building tool that combines a traditional discussion board with social media features. Yellowdig integrates with Canvas and allows instructors to view analytics on engagement. The robust grading features make it effective at scale, including high enrollment classes.
